Output 40156766aa034b020713d54c73d38accb3f9168b4b6b5bc361867623fd09d382:1

value
3105031707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 062107aed007e5f466eca8720084a1ff0b890300 OP_EQUALVERIFY OP_CHECKSIG
address
1ZQd7kYcETNeiMD1GAVbaKKav83WXEt3W
transaction
40156766aa034b020713d54c73d38accb3f9168b4b6b5bc361867623fd09d382
spent
true